The placement trend at Amity School of Engineering and Technology over the past three years is mentioned below:Particulars Placement Statistics 2023Placement Statistics 2024Placement Statistics 2025the highest packageINR 61.75 LPAINR 42.1 LPAINR 35.9 LPAAverage packageINR 8.83 LPAINR 8.42 LPAINR 9.6 LPAMedian packageNANAINR 6 LPACompanies visited300300110International placement5103

For BBA + MBA placements, Amity University, Noida generally has a slightly stronger and more consistent record than Lovely Professional University (LPU) — Amity's placement drives often report higher average packages and long lists of recruiters with large numbers of offers, with many students securing roles above ₹6–8 LPA and high packages around ₹25–60 LPA in recent years. LPU also delivers good outcomes with strong placement rates and some high salary offers, but its average and median packages for business courses tend to be slightly lower than Amity's overall figures. In short, Amity Noida edges out LPU for overall placements in BBA/MBA, though actual results depend on your performance, specialisation, and skills you build during the course.

Who are the top recruiters during Amity School of Engineering and Technology placements?

Top recruiters such as JSW, Amazon, Asian Paints and Wipro visited the campus in recent past during Amity School of Engineering and Technology placements. Over 100 companies visited during the placement drive 2025.

When comparing B.Tech in Computer Science & Engineering (CSE) among Lovely Professional University (LPU), Galgotias University, and Amity University, all three are decent private options, but there are some clear differences to help you decide: LPU generally stands out overall because it has a higher NIRF engineering rank, broader industry exposure and stronger placement statistics for CSE, with average packages often around ₹6–7 LPA and several students getting very high offers from big tech companies like Microsoft and Amazon. Amity also has good placements in CSE, with average packages often in the ₹6–8 LPA range and a strong recruiter network, but its reputation varies by campus and student experience. Galgotias University offers a solid engineering programme with average CTCs around ₹5 LPA–₹6 LPA and respectable industry ties, but typically lags slightly behind LPU and Amity in overall placement statistics and national rankings. In summary, for B.Tech CSE, LPU is often considered the best choice among the three in terms of placements, industry exposure, and overall opportunities, followed by Amity, and then Galgotias, but you should also consider fees, campus culture, and your personal priorities before making a final decision.

Amity University Noida admissions for UG and PG courses usually start from January/ February as per the website of the university. Students can apply online and pay INR 1500 as application fees. The amount is taken from official sources and can change.

The salary packages offered to MBA students during Amity University Noida placements 2025 are presented below:ParticularsMBA Statistics – 2025the highest packageINR 26.30 LPAAverage packageINR 7.35 LPAMedain packageINR 6.5 LPA
